How do I know if I have a slab leak in my Mebane home?

Common signs of a slab leak in Mebane include unexplained increases in your water bill, warm or wet spots on floors, the sound of running water when all fixtures are off, low water pressure, cracks appearing in walls or flooring, and mold or mildew odors. How do you find a slab leak without breaking up my floor in Mebane?

Phoenician Plumbing uses electronic leak detection equipment — acoustic listening devices, electronic amplifiers, and thermal imaging cameras — to pinpoint the leak location under your Mebane slab before any concrete is cut. This precision means we only open the slab where necessary, minimizing repair costs and disruption.

What causes slab leaks in Mebane homes?

Slab leaks in Mebane are most commonly caused by pipe corrosion in copper lines from soil chemistry or water quality, pipe movement from soil shifting or seismic activity, poor original installation with pipes that rub against concrete, and high water pressure that stresses pipe walls over time. Older homes with copper supply lines are most susceptible.

Should I repair or reroute my slab leak in Mebane?

The decision depends on the pipe's overall condition, the leak location, and the cost comparison. If your copper pipes are generally in good condition and the leak is isolated, direct access repair makes sense. If pipes throughout your Mebane home are corroded or you have had multiple slab leaks, rerouting or full repiping is the more economical long-term choice.
